Abstract

To reduce energy use for space heating, the optimization of operation of heating system has always been a key issue in north China. In this study, on the basis of field survey results, one existing regulation mode of supply water temperature and its effects on indoor environment and energy use were analyzed. Then the simulation-based optimization method of supply water temperature was pointed out by comparing the relationship among outdoor temperature, indoor temperature, room base temperature and supply water temperature. The optimization effects were presented by comparing room indoor temperatures and energy consumption before and after optimization. As a result, the simulation-based method proposed in this study was proved to be an effective way to optimize the operation of heating system, by which “excessive heating” can be significantly decreased, and average daily indoor temperature can basically be kept at its set point.
